CC -!- FUNCTION: CAN TRANSFORM NIH 3T3 CELLS FROM A HUMAN STOMACH TUMOR CC (HST) AND FROM KARPOSI'S SARCOMA (KS3). IT HAS A MITOGENIC CC ACTIVITY. CC -!- SIMILARITY: BELONGS TO THE HEPARIN-BINDING GROWTH FACTORS FAMILY. CC -------------------------------------------------------------------------- CC This SWISS-PROT entry is copyright.
